Stephanie Polzin & Tina Evenson Join Primary care team at Lake Region Healthcare

(FERGUS FALLS, Minn.) Stephanie Polzin, Certified Physician Assistant and Tina Evenson, Family Nurse Practitioner have both recently joined the Primary Care team on the Lake Region Healthcare (LRH) Medical Staff.  

Polzin joins the LRH Primary Care department in the Internal Medicine specialty. She received her MS, Physician Assistant Studies from the University of South Dakota in Vermillion, SD and completed her undergraduate studies at Anoka-Ramsey Community College and Concordia College, Moorhead. She is a member of the American Academy of Physician Assistants.

Most recently Stephanie worked with the University of Minnesota Physicians Masonic Cancer Center in Minneapolis providing outpatient care to patients with newly diagnosed or chronic oncological and hematological malignancies.

Stephanie said she is excited about joining the family & internal medicine staff in the LRH Primary Care Department to offer quality health care and serve as an advocate of wellness for patients.

Tina Evenson, will be working primarily at Lake Region Healthcare’s Walk-In Clinic. After working as a Registered nurse for over 14 years, Evenson completed her Master’s Degree in Nursing & Science at North Dakota State University. This is where she also completed her clinical FNP practicum with emphasis in family practice, cardiology, endocrinology, obstetrics and orthopedic care.

Most recently she has worked at the Sanford Health Broadway Clinic in Alexandria and at Health Partners Urgent Care in Apple Valley and St. Paul. “My decision to enter the medical field was a natural result of my passion to improve wellness,” Evenson said. “I enjoy working with patients of all ages and genders but I do have a special interest in Women’s Health and Pediatrics,” she added. Tobacco cessation and weight loss are also quality of life topics she is particularly interested in helping people achieve.
